Transaction 10883a8a590eeeceae149529a2785fb1583d55fbb08e3f2f367f308e9d284d3d

1 Input
2 Outputs
  • 10883a8a590eeeceae149529a2785fb1583d55fbb08e3f2f367f308e9d284d3d:0
  • value  1511746
    address  17X3KRBgPKPygNoo6euRpgcbAiLa7Fqeuh
  • 10883a8a590eeeceae149529a2785fb1583d55fbb08e3f2f367f308e9d284d3d:1
  • value  2636
    address  15LVpNCFWivpPT9nESrgK7tNQXo85kbqVo